Job Description

Category Schools - Special Education Teacher Job Type Contract Make a meaningful impact as a Special Education Teacher and support students' growth in a vibrant school environment near Saint Matthews, SC. As a valued member of the educational team, you'll guide learners with exceptionalities toward academic and personal achievement, cultivating a classroom atmosphere built on inclusivity and empowerment. This contract opportunity is ideal for compassionate, resourceful educators eager to foster independence and lifelong learning skills.
Qualifications & Experience:
Hold a valid state teaching certification in Special Education (or eligibility for certification) Bachelor's degree in Special Education or a related field (Master's degree preferred) Previous experience working with diverse learners and implementing IEPs Strong classroom management and communication abilities Familiarity with differentiated instruction, adaptive technology, and evidence-based strategies Genuine commitment to student growth and collaboration with faculty and families
Responsibilities:
Deliver engaging, individualized instruction aligned with students' IEPs and educational goals Foster a positive, supportive classroom environment that encourages participation and growth Assess student needs, monitor progress, and maintain accurate documentation Collaborate with general education staff, related service providers, and families to support student success Develop creative accommodations and modifications to facilitate equitable learning Participate in IEP meetings, team planning sessions, and ongoing professional development
